Output ed88a7496c154b0732049b0a33f19d777ee93e266403c2610d73e0ee1b31a035:20

value
171000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f188f7bdbc0496f85c53e4313899a89c682df36a OP_EQUAL
address
3Pi8rTeS8x45Td4chMzpLyeTYqUqyKu7ch
transaction
ed88a7496c154b0732049b0a33f19d777ee93e266403c2610d73e0ee1b31a035